Background technology
Punch press is exactly a punching type forcing press, punching production primarily directed to sheet material, by mould can make blanking, Punching, shaping, drawing, finishing, fine, shaping, riveting etc. are operated, and are widely used in mechanical processing industry.Punch press pair during work Sheet material is pressed, and finished product blanking is completed on sheet material or punching is completed on finished product, it is necessary to match somebody with somebody mould and lower mould in unification group, will Sheet material is placed in therebetween, and pressure is applied by drift, it is deformed or blanking.
With the requirement more and more higher of the development people to equipment of society, so that also to assembling the processing of the plate of the equipment It is required that also more and more higher.And because the fabrication hole on plate cannot in the lump be processed in place in punching press plate, it is therefore desirable to falling Sheet Metal Forming Technology hole is repositioned on the plate of material, and easily there is the phenomenon of deviations in the plate produced in batches, so as to can cause Monoblock plate is scrapped;Also need to, by a dead lift, increase when the operation such as also needing to be flattened, clean after the completion of sheet forming in addition The labour intensity for having added part to process.

Specific embodiment
With reference to the accompanying drawings and examples, the present invention is described in more detail.Wherein identical parts identical Reference is represented.It should be noted that the word "front", "rear", "left", "right", the "up" and "down" that are used in description below The direction in accompanying drawing is referred to, word " bottom surface " and " top surface ", " interior " and " outward " are referred respectively to towards or away from particular elements The direction of geometric center.
Shown in reference picture 1-4, a kind of guide plate flattens cleaning conveying device production line, include controller and decompressor 1, For conveying the conveying device 2 of finished product plate, the press 3 for flattening finished product plate and for cleaning finished product plate Cleaning machine 4, should be noted herein the controller can for Programmable Logic Controller, and decompressor 1 namely in the market is rushed Bed, and press 3 and cleaning machine 4 belong to prior art, can commercially purchase and directly use.
Decompressor 1 is included for the first punch press 11 of the punching press location hole on finished product plate and in finished product Second punch press 12 in Sheet Metal Forming Technology hole on plate, is provided with the second punch press 12 for supplying what finished product plate was positioned by location hole Stamping mold;The stamping mold can make finished product plate accurately be placed on Working position, so as to avoid finished product plate again The deviations phenomenon easily occurred after positioning, is conducive to improving yield rate.
Conveying device 2 include for convey to the first punch press 11 for finished product plate orientation conveying mechanism 21, for general Orientation conveying mechanism 21 on finished product plate be placed on the first punch press 11 the first manipulator 22, for being rushed through the first punch press 11 Finished product plate after pressure processing convey positioning conveyer structure 23 to the second punch press 12, for by positioning conveyer structure 23 into The second manipulator 24 that product plate is placed on the second punch press 12, for being pushed away through the finished product plate after the punch process of the second punch press 12 It is sent to the delivery device 25 in press 3.Wherein the first manipulator 22 and the second manipulator 24 belong to prior art, can be from city Buying sets its working procedure and can be used after coming on field.
Orientation conveying mechanism 21 includes conveyer belt 212 for conveying finished product plate and for expecting in production board The fixation kit 213 being fixed during up to specified location;Finished product plate is conveyed on conveyer belt 212 and passes through fixation kit afterwards in place 213 are fixed, then hold finished product plate pawl by the first manipulator 22 and carry out location hole processing onto the first punch press 11.It is fixed Position conveying mechanism 23 is included for the placement seat 233 for production board material positioning installation and for driving placement seat 233 to move To the moving assembly 234 of specified location;First manipulator 22 will hold placement seat 233 through the finished product plate pawl of the first punch press 11 again On, moving assembly 234 drives placement seat 233 to be slid onto specified location again, and the second manipulator 24 holds to second finished product plate pawl Fabrication hole processing is carried out on punch press 12.
Finished product plate is conveyed through conveyer belt 212 to the first punch press 11, and controller is opened when production board is expected up to specified location Dynamic fixation kit 213 fixes finished product plate, and controller restarts the first manipulator 22 will be arrived by fixed production board material clamping On first punch press 11, the first punch press 11 stamp out location hole after the first manipulator 22 again by production board material clamping to placement seat 233 On, finished product plate is positioned on placement seat 233 by location hole, and controller starts moving assembly 234 and drives placement seat 233 to slide To the second punch press 12, controller restarts the second manipulator 24 will slide production board material clamping in place to the second punch press 12, Second punch press 12 stamps out after fabrication hole the second manipulator 24 by production board material clamping to delivery device 25, through delivery device 25 Finished product plate was pushed into press 3 and cleaning machine 4 successively.
Above-mentioned production line conveys finished product plate by conveyer belt 212, and is fixed when production board is expected up to specified location Component 213 is fixed, then holds finished product plate pawl by the first manipulator 22 and carry out location hole processing onto the first punch press 11, treats The first manipulator 22 will be held on placement seat 233 through the finished product plate pawl of the first punch press 11 again after first punch press 11 is processed, and moves Dynamic component 234 drives placement seat 233 to be slid onto the specified location of next step operation again, and the second manipulator 24 holds finished product plate pawl Fabrication hole processing is carried out on to the second punch press 12, the second manipulator 24 again will be through the second punch press 12 after the second punch press 12 is processed Finished product plate pawl hold delivery device 25, finished product plate is pushed into operation in press 3, press again through delivery device 25 3 discharge end is connected with the feed end of cleaning machine 4, and cleaning is directly entered when finished product plate is exported from the discharge end of press 3 Operation in machine 4.It is above-mentioned whole by the execution of controller detection control Zhe Ge mechanisms, it is prevented effectively from after finished product plate is repositioned easily to go out Existing deviations phenomenon, is conducive to improving yield rate;Also avoid finished product plate that artificial removing is also needed to when carrying out other operations Fortune, effectively reduces the labour intensity of part processing, so as to be conducive to improving the automaticity of production line processing.
The positioning conveying that positioning conveyer structure 23 includes positioning carriage 231 and is arranged on positioning carriage 231 Slide rail 232, placement seat 233 can slide with it along the length direction of positioning conveyer slideway 232 and be connected, and be provided with placement seat 233 For the locating rod 2331 in the location hole for inserting finished product plate;Moving assembly 234 is included and is arranged at positioning conveyer slideway 232 The servomotor 2341 of one end and the transmission belt 2342 for driving placement seat 233 to be slid on positioning conveyer slideway 232, Transmission belt 2342 is connected with the output end of servomotor 2341, and servomotor 2341 drives placement seat by transmission belt 2342 233 slide on positioning conveyer slideway 232.Be placed into finished product plate when on placement seat 233 by the first manipulator 22, locating rod Finished product plate is set effectively to be positioned in the location hole of 2331 insertion finished product plates, controller controls servomotor 2341 to make peace Put seat 233 and be slid onto specified location, which can be easy to controller to control production board to expect up to specified location, be prevented effectively from The deviations phenomenon that finished product plate easily occurs after repositioning.
The two ends of the positioning length direction of conveyer slideway 232 are rotatably connected to the transmission for transmission belt 2342 to be tensioned Roller, the output end of servomotor 2341 is axially connected with live-roller by shaft coupling, is bonded on two live-rollers and is connected to mutually The cone pulley 2343 of cooperation, transmission belt 2342 is tensioned between the cone pulley 2343 on two live-rollers;By two cone pulleys 2343 Cooperation can adjust the rate of tension and transmission speed of transmission belt 2342, be conducive to improving using scope and service life.
Positioning conveyer slideway 232 is provided with two and be arranged in parallel along its length between the two, moving assembly 234 The placement seat 233 on two positioning conveyer slideways 232 is driven alternately toward polyslip.Two placement seats 233 are used alternatingly, favorably In the operating efficiency for improving positioning conveyer structure 23.
Orientation conveying mechanism 21 includes orientation carriage 211, and conveyer belt 212 is included for conveying the defeated of finished product plate Roller 2121, conveying roller 2121 is sent to be rotationally connected with orientation carriage 211, conveying roller 2121 is provided with several and arranges successively Row are set, and orientation conveying mechanism 21 is also included for driving the motor of conveying roller 2121 (not regarded in motor figure Go out), the delivery end of motor is connected with the chain (depending on not going out in chain figure) for driving each conveying roller 2121, each conveying The gear with chain engaged transmission is provided with roller 2121, motor drives each conveying roller 2121 to rotate and realizes production board The conveying of material.The simple structure easily realized, driven each conveying roller 2121 by motor, is conducive to the steady of finished product plate Fixed conveying.
Fixation kit 213 includes baffle plate 2131, the use being fixed on orientation carriage 211 near the one end of the first punch press 11 In detection finished product plate whether first sensor, the jaw cylinder for clamping position finished product plate contradicted with baffle plate 2131 2132, jaw cylinder 2132 is provided with two and runs simultaneously, and two jaw cylinders 2132 are arranged along finished product plate conveying direction Row are set;Two such jaw cylinder 2132 can be held on the two ends of finished product plate length direction, so as to be conducive to finished product Plate is fixed vertically along its conveying direction.
Motor drives conveying roller 2121 to drive finished product plate to be conveyed to baffle plate 2131 when rotating, when first sensor inspection Measure controller after finished product plate and baffle plate 2131 are contradicted and start jaw cylinder 2132, the jaw of jaw cylinder 2132 is by production board Material clamping is fixed.The fixation kit 213 can be fixed on predeterminated position when production board is expected up to specified location, favorably Accurately it is placed on next station after the first manipulator 22 grips finished product plate from fixation kit 213.
The guide plate for limiting finished product plate to two side slips is provided with orientation carriage 211 along its length 2111, guide plate 2111 is provided with two and be arranged in parallel, and two guide plates 2111 are respectively positioned on the top of conveying roller 2121, and And can it is close to each other or away from sliding;Guide plate 2111 is provided for finished product plate and can orient conveying, it is to avoid finished product The left and right of plate offsets and is unfavorable for fixation kit 213 by finished product plate fix in position.
Guiding slide bar 2112 is provided through along its width on orientation carriage 211, is oriented on slide bar 2112 and is slid The guiding base plate 2113 for connecting guide plate 2111 is connected with, is bolted with for band action-oriented base plate on orientation carriage 211 2113 regulation screw mandrel 2114, regulation screw mandrel 2114 and guiding slide bar 2112 be arranged in parallel, are driven when rotating regulation screw mandrel 2114 Base plate 2113 is oriented in the case where the spacing guide effect of slide bar 2112 is oriented to along its axial slip.Two guide plates 2111 can be mutual Closer or far from be designed to allow orientation conveying mechanism 21 adapt to different width dimensions finished product plate, improve its applicable model Enclose;And two regulations of guide plate 2111 can be adopted and manually carried out, rotating regulation screw mandrel 2114 makes two guide plates 2111 spacing can more tally with the actual situation.
Delivery device 25 includes push frame 251 and is rotationally connected with push frame 251 for conveying finished product plate Push rolls 252, push rolls 252 are provided with several and are arranged in order setting;Press 3 is arranged on push frame 251, is flattened Machine 3 includes slicking-in roller and the pressing motor 31 for driving slicking-in roller to rotate, and the delivery end for flattening motor 31 is connected with use In the chain for driving each push rolls 252, the gear with chain engaged transmission is provided with each push rolls 252, flattens motor 31 are rotated so as to realize the conveying of finished product plate by chain-driving each push rolls 252.It is used to drive in said structure to flatten The pressing motor 31 of roller is used to drive the rotation of each push rolls 252 simultaneously, both can conveniently realize push rolls 252 and press 3 Synchronous operation, decrease device configuration, advantageously reduce device fabrication cost.
Delivery device 25 is also included to be arranged at and pushed on frame 251 and positioned at the push cylinder of the top of push rolls 252 253 and for detecting the second sensor of finished product plate transfer position, the piston rod end of push cylinder 253 rotates connection Having can compress wheel 254 closer or far from push rolls 252, compress wheel 254 and be located at the top of push rolls 252 and near press 3 charging aperture;Finished product plate on push rolls 252 to the course of conveying of press 3 in be delivered to and compress below wheel 254, and quilt Second sensor detects rear controller and starts push cylinder 253 and will compress wheel 254 and is pressed against finished product plate top, now pushes Roller 252 is driving wheel, and it is driven pulley to compress wheel 254, and is held on the opposite sides of finished product plate, so as to finished product plate be pushed away Enter in press 3.Due to press 3 be by the machine of finished product plate correction leveling, set up compress wheel 254 can be by production board Material is pushed in press 3, therefore the structure can make finished product plate smoothly by between two slicking-in rollers, improving production board Smooth degree during material correction.
